"Decades ago, while working on far-flung excavations, archaeologist Jill Weber uncovered an appreciation for wine, and she’s been championing the world’s unsung wine regions back home in Philly since. In Jet Wine Bar’s shaded garden, sample wines by the glass from Turkey, Bulgaria, and Slovenia." - Regan Stephens
"The wine experts at Jet Wine Bar on South Street turned a lot next door into a little oasis for drinking outside. Along with the red, white, and rosé, there are cans of beer and cider, summery cocktails, spiked water ice, and snacks, like truffle and black pepper popcorn." - Rachel Vigoda, Sarah Maiellano
"This South Street wine bar is known for its eclectic wine selection. Its wine club is evidence of this, offering two expertly selected bottles of wine per month, a discount on all bottle shop purchases (and dine-in checks). Members also receive $10 off all ticketed events on its calendar and unlock the option to book a reservation in its popular wine garden for parties of 6 or fewer." - George Banks-Weston

"Globetrotting archaeologist Jill Weber drew inspiration from wine regions she’s visited around the world for this South Street staple. Jet Wine Bar pours off-the-beaten-path styles like Georgian Rkatsiteli and Turkish Çalkarası rosé. Classes, tastings, a wine club, a wine retail shop, and a rollicking wine garden keep things fresh." - Sarah Maiellano
